WebScrapie, the archetype transmissible spongiform encephalopathy (TSE), is a naturally occurring prion disease of sheep, goats, and mouflon (Ovis musimon ). 2–4 Scrapie was first reported in Europe in the 16th century (England 1732 and Germany 1759), 5–7 with references to the disease in literature from the early Chinese and Roman epochs. 8 ...
